Signs That a Tree Needs to Be Removed
Some typical indicators that a tree needs to be removed include:
- Fungus or mold
- Rot , dead branches , missing bark or leaves , and other signs of decay
- Cracking between branches , especially large heavy ones
- Cracks in the trunk , especially deep cracks
- The trunk branches off in different directions into multiple large , heavy branches
When you spot a tree leaning or find raised dirt around the base, you should arrange an immediate evaluation, as it is at a greater risk of falling. If a tree is nearing your house or utility lines, you may also need an assessment, as numerous communities and utility companies have particular policies for tree proximity.
Do Tree Removal Companies Need to be Licensed in Michigan?
Michigan does not have specific licensing requirements for tree removal companies, but it’s important to check with your local municipal government to ensure your provider meets the requirements in your area. Always look for a legitimate business that has workers compensation and liability insurance. You may feel more at ease entrusting your tree removal needs to a licensed general contractor. An individual can also become a licensed arborist through the International Society of Arboriculture (ISA). While not required, this certification indicates that an individual is trained in all aspects of arboriculture and follows the ISA’s code of ethics.
